Webb24 aug. 2024 · In your SharePoint site, you may try adding the Discussion Board app via setting>Add an app. When you enable external sharing for the SharePoint site, external users that you invite to the site can join the discussion. Note: the Discussion Board app is only available in classic site and modern team site, but not communication site. WebbIn SharePoint, you can add news posts from your SharePoint start page. At the top of the SharePoint start page, click Create news post. Choose the site where you want to publish your news post. You'll get a blank news post page on the site you chose, ready for you to fill out. Create your news post using the instructions Create the news post. impurity\u0027s 1k
